My substrate is cut up shredded coco, small bits of charcoal, and chopped sphag. On top of that I have a layer of the reptile bark (because it's tiny), and then another layer of sphag.

I made a hill on the left side of the tank by adding a pile of bark, topped with chopped sphag and terrarium moss on top. Hopefully this will allow it to get the moisture it needs without the rot. It made the tank more interesting anyway. It's a work in progress
